Investigating the support mechanisms provided by macrophages in human erythropoiesis
<p>Definitive erythropoiesis takes place within the bone marrow in erythroblastic islands, where the central macrophage plays a role in the expansion and terminal differentiation of surrounding erythroid cells. Central macrophages have been shown to promote erythropoiesis, although the precise...
